The Struggle of Self-Transformation in 'What I'm Becoming'

Cage The Elephant's song 'What I'm Becoming' delves into the emotional turmoil and self-reflection of someone grappling with their own transformation.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a person who feels trapped in their own mind, unable to move forward despite a desire to change. The imagery of drifting across the floor and being tied to a place suggests a sense of stagnation and confinement. This internal struggle is further emphasized by the repeated apologies to a loved one, indicating a deep sense of guilt and regret for the pain caused by this personal journey.

The song's chorus, 'I'm so sorry, honey, for what I'm becoming,' highlights the protagonist's awareness of the distance growing between them and their partner. The repeated lines, 'Never meant to hurt you, no, never meant to make you cry,' underscore the unintended consequences of their transformation. This suggests that the changes the protagonist is undergoing are not only affecting their own sense of self but also straining their relationships. The use of everyday objects like a window, a sparrow, and a table adds a layer of normalcy to the otherwise intense emotional experience, grounding the listener in the reality of the protagonist's world.

Cage The Elephant is known for their raw and introspective lyrics, often exploring themes of personal struggle and growth. 'What I'm Becoming' is no exception, offering a poignant look at the complexities of self-identity and the impact it has on those around us. The song serves as a reminder that personal growth is often a painful and isolating process, but it is also a necessary part of life. The emotional weight of the lyrics, combined with the band's signature sound, creates a powerful and relatable narrative that resonates with listeners on a deep level.
